Netflix's hit series 'Stranger Things' gears up for its fifth and final season, set to premiere in 2025. The streaming giant recently unveiled the tit ...
Following that big behind-the-scenes "Stranger Things" update we got earlier in the year, the streamer has dropped a new video (embedded below) confirming a few new details about the new season: a ...